The Opel Sintra 3.0i-V6 CD is a mpv powered by a petrol engine delivering 201 hp (148 kW). It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 10.8 s and reaches a top speed of 201 km/h. Fuel efficiency stands at 11.5 l/100 km combined, CO₂ emissions of 275 g/km. Drive is routed to the front-wheel-drive axle via an automatic. This variant was introduced in 1997 as part of the Opel Sintra (1997-1999) generation, and sits alongside 2 other variants in this generation.
